Transaction eb62ee7556cc861698b120e9c144f95247d422e4506dae0ff684ee0508038705
2 Input
2 Outputs
- eb62ee7556cc861698b120e9c144f95247d422e4506dae0ff684ee0508038705:0
- eb62ee7556cc861698b120e9c144f95247d422e4506dae0ff684ee0508038705:1
value 1500000
address 371MZaVzTmDFz4Nffd16WGJEzD7G8DMzZW
value 125458
address 1KsUPzgmLrmPUWSRcK7vGHnQaaegxJqwEk